Skif sighed heavily as she watched the sun dip behind the mountains, turning the blue sky to a dreamy lilac. The pale Fae had her frills drooping down at the side of her cheeks, 'Will he even arrive?' she thought to herself sadly. Immediately after her doubtful thoughts, rustling broke the lonely silence and from within the bushes a crystalline Fae walked out. His amber eyes darted all over the clearing before landing on Skif. His frills immediately perked up and he respectfully dipped his head to her. "Skif?" he asked, though he quite clearly knew that it was indeed her. The petite dragoness nodded shyly - she was not used to dragons showing such a gesture of respect towards her.

The tan Fae brought himself back up and took a few steps toward Skif. "I'm Oscar, a professional archer and hunter within my clan - as you already know I've come to break your curse" He chirped proudly, his frills elegantly displayed. Skif took a few uncomfortable steps back as Oscar seemed to overwhelm her. "T-that's nice!" she attempted to sound as enthusiastic as she could, but this dragon - though very formal and proper - is too much for her. 'He isn't the one' she thought silently to herself as doubts began to pierce the hope in her heart.

Oscar had been observing Skif and noticed her discomfort right away. "Oh, sorry! I probably shouldn't get that close on the first encounter" he mumbled awkwardly. Skif gave a small laugh and shook her head "It's fine." she said quietly, her voice almost a soft whisper.

Oscar desperately glanced around the small clearing for an ice-breaker to their awkward conversation. 'C'mon! You practiced with Azoth - pride and power wins every lady!' he reminded himself forcefully.

Suddenly, Oscar remembered what he had planned for their meeting (and what had taken him so long to arrive). He swiftly padded to the edge of the clearing and narrowed his eyes to slits as he attempted to see the place. He gave a frustrated snort before turning back to Skif. The dream-like pale Fae had been watching Oscar with unhidden confusion. Oscar nodded for her to come "Come with me, I had something prepared for you" he explained as his wings lifted him off the forest floor.

Skif hesitantly followed him closely, staying silent throughout the short journey to "the spot". When they had finally arrived Skif's jaw dropped in awe, her pale yellow eyes glistening as she took in the sight. They had flown over the forest and were now at the edge of a meadow that had beautiful heather growing for miles on end. at the end of the heather was a small clearing where a tree stump was covered by a small cloth, two diner plates and a small transparent vase with a rose in the middle. Next to the tree stump was a basket from which mouth-watering smells drifted off. But, behind the small stump and meadow was a huge cherry blossom which had it's branches and trunk covered in faerie lights.

Skif's eyes swelled up with tears "It's beautiful" she whispered, trying hard not to choke. Oscar gave an embarrassed smile "I heard about a prince coming to break the spell - I'm sure this is nothing compared to what he had done". Skif crossly glanced at him "Don't you compare yourself to others! This is amazing, no one has ever done such for me. It's truly beautiful" she ranted, the scolding soon becoming an overflow of compliments and gratitude. Oscar was listening intently, but with every word his petite face grew pinker and pinker.

Skif smiled shyly and broke out into small giggling. "Your face is almost completely pink!" she pointed out "it's cute..." she added quietly to herself, but Oscar smiled happily as he heard the silent whisper. 'I think... I will break the curse...' he thought hopefully.

Oscar gestured towards to tree stump table, "Shall we?" He asked politely. Skif nodded, eagerly padding down towards the table and sitting down. Oscar took his place opposite her. "I had prepared a cake for us, it's the reason why I was late, you see. I decided to bake it right before arriving, seeing as it tastes the best when it's warm and newly baked." He explained as he took out a small cake from the basket. "So that's what smelled absolutely delicious!" Skif exclaimed as the scents she previously had scented were even stronger now.

Oscar took out a small knife from the basket and cut the cake in the center. He then proceeded to place a piece each in his and Skif's plate. Skif couldn't hold back and dug into the mouth-watering cake. The cake was spongy, yet crispy at the same time. She swallowed down the piece and immediately downed another one. "This tastes fantastic! What is it?" she asked as she proceeded to stuff mouthfuls of the cake. Oscar gave a small chuckled before tapping the side of his nose "It's a secret! But, if you'd really like to know, it's my mother's recipe. She's a cake extraordinaire, Sornieth's best baker! She created a new recipe to which only her and I know the steps to." he explained, watching Skif with pride. The pale Fae nodded, "That must be really fun having a mother who's a baker" Oscar shrugged at the reply.

The two then exchanged gossip, laughed for hours and talked about each other's interests. The sun has fully set by now, and the moon was beginning to rise - revealing stars which glistened over the Faes' heads.

Finally, Skif decided to ask about the beautifully decorated cherry blossom. "So, what's this about?" She asked, pointing to the tree. Oscar stood up and padded up to the cherry blossom before sitting down underneath it and patting the floor - a gesture showing Skif to sit beside him. She obeyed and sat close to him, watching the glowing cherry blossom in awe.

"Skif, I really like you..." The small Fae was brought back to reality by Oscar's soft voice. "I think I might even love you." The words echoed in Skif's head. Suddenly doubt and fear collapsed over her, she fell down, her paws over her head in fear.

Oscar jumped and rushed over beside her. "Skif! Are you okay?" He asked as the dragoness trembled under his paws. "What if you aren't the one? I don't want to hurt you!"she cried out finally. Oscar's heart sank, "What... do you mean? Don't you feel the same way?" he asked, begging for his ears to be playing tricks on him.

Skif looked up at Oscar, shaking her head "No, I do love you! I feel the exact same way and more!" She said as tears ran down her fragile cheeks. "Then the curse can be broken! If we feel the same way, isn't that the sign of something true?" Oscar pleaded. Skif looked down at her paws, tears trickling down and dropping onto the floor.

Oscar lifted her head and placed his lips onto hers, embracing a strong kiss between the two. After a few moments, Oscar drew away and looked at Skif hopefully.

The Fae, however, had a paw over her mouth and tears continuing to flow from her moon-like eyes. Oscar's heart shattered to pieces. "It didn't work..." He whispered dreadfully. He grabbed Skif's hand and pulled her closer into a tight hug. "I'm sorry Skif, I really thought I'd be the one" He choked on the words. Skif attempted a reply, but her words came out in chokes and sobs.

Hours seemed to pass by. The two were no longer sobbing, instead they sat in silent numbness, still embraced in their hug.

Oscar was the first to speak, "Skif... I-I... Sorry..." Skif shook her head, her eyes gazing into the distance. "It's not your fault, it's my fault I have this wretched curse in the first place..." Oscar put his head in his hands, debating with himself on what to do. Then finally, he got a thought.

Oscar sat up straight and brought Skif to sit upright too. He gazed into her eyes, both of their gazes reflected nothing but grief. "Skif, listen. I'm not the one, this means you have to continue your journey to find the one who's truly your true love. But... I can't survive without having a piece of you... Skif, will you have hatchlings with me? I will raise one with me and have a piece of you forever. I love you too much to let you go without having something for me to remember you by." Oscar finished with him holding back a sob, his voice was croaky and hoarse from the crying earlier.

Skif was silent for a few moments, then suddenly, she nodded. "Yes, I will have hatchlings with you, Oscar. Just... promise me to bring them up with love and care." Oscar nodded, bringing Skif in their last ever hug. "I will take care of them".
